Two plays about cultural identity from Scotland and Catalonia, which received their English-language premières in August 1999 at the Royal Lyceum Theatre as part of the Edinburgh International Festival in Traverse Theatre Company productions The Speculator by David Greig is set in Paris in 1720. The French playwright Pierre Marivaux is playing games with love and chance. Europe is in chaos. And John Law, a Scot from Edinburgh, is the richest and most powerful man in the world. He upsets order and alters the value of money. How long can his influence last? David Greig's new play is a rambunctious costume drama that toys with history and questions whether imagination can, or should, triumph over truth. Some events in the play are true. The rest is speculation. The Meeting by Lluïsa Cunillé and translated by John London, follows a string of chance encounters. A businessman on a journey crosses paths and shares his life with those of passing strangers. An old man is convinced there is buried treasure in the city park. A watchmaker talks to him about time. A young man and a traveller speak of their discontent. Shared pasts and common desires create a web of complexity in Luisa Cunillé's challenging play, turning random meetings into rendezvous with destiny. 'The Speculator' is an intelligent, passionate costume drama with anachronisms about the illusionary quality of wealth, set in Paris in 1720. Europe is in chaos. The French playwright Pierre Marivaux is playing games with love and chance, having an affair with his leading lady. And John Law, a Scot from Edinburgh, is the richest and most powerful man in the world: he has persuaded everyone that pieces of paper are worth more than gold. France has given up on petty metal currency, its wealth based on shares of the new lands in America. As only Law understands the abstractions of his financial system, how long can the dream last? 'The Speculator' was first performed in Catalan in 1999 at the Mercat de les Flors, Barcelona; it was first performed in English at the Royal Lyceum Theatre, Edinburgh in the same year.

In The Futures, Emily Lambert, senior writer at Forbes magazine, tells us the rich and dramatic history of the Chicago Mercantile Exchange and Chicago Board of Trade, which together comprised the original, most bustling futures market in the world. She details the emergence of the futures business as a kind of meeting place for gamblers and farmers and its subsequent transformation into a sophisticated electronic market where contracts are traded at lightning-fast speeds. Lambert also details the disastrous effects of Wall Street's adoption of the futures contract without the rules and close-knit social bonds that had made trading it in Chicago work so well. Ultimately Lambert argues that the futures markets are the real "free" markets and that speculators, far from being mere parasites, can serve a vital economic and social function given the right architecture. The traditional futures market, she explains, because of its written and cultural limits, can serve as a useful example for how markets ought to work and become a tonic for our current financial ills.
